Curry Continues to Defy Father Time, Warriors Edge Spurs

Stephen Curry, proving once again why he’s considered one of the greatest shooters of all time, poured in 49 points on a remarkably efficient 16-of-26 shooting, including 9-of-17 from beyond the arc, leading the Golden State Warriors to a narrow 109-108 victory over the San Antonio Spurs. While Victor Wembanyama showcased flashes of his potential – finishing with 26 points, 12 rebounds, 4 assists, and 3 blocks – it wasn’t enough to overcome Curry’s brilliance. Wemby’s impact was undeniable, with impressive dunks on Draymond Green and clutch shots, but the Warriors’ experience ultimately prevailed. This game wasn’t just about individual stats; it was a glimpse into the future of the league, with the rookie phenom testing the limits of what’s possible on the court.

Pistons Achieve Historic Feat: Ninth Straight Win

In a stunning turn of events, the Detroit Pistons secured their ninth consecutive victory, defeating the Philadelphia 76ers 114-105. Remarkably, Detroit achieved this feat despite being without key players like Cade Cunningham, Tobias Harris, Ausar Thompson, and Jalen Durren. Javonte Green led the charge with 21 points, fueling a team effort that represents the Pistons’ longest winning streak since 2008. This isn’t just a hot streak; it’s a testament to the team’s resilience and a potential turning point for a franchise that has struggled for years. The Pistons’ success highlights the importance of team chemistry and adaptability, even in the face of adversity.

Harden Rolls Back the Years with 82nd Career Triple-Double

James Harden reminded everyone of his all-around game, delivering a vintage performance with 41 points, 14 rebounds, and 11 assists in the LA Clippers’ 133-127 double-overtime win against the Dallas Mavericks. This performance marked Harden’s 82nd career triple-double, solidifying his place among the NBA’s elite playmakers. With Kawhi Leonard and Chris Paul sidelined, Harden stepped up as the primary offensive force, showcasing his ability to control the game’s tempo and create opportunities for his teammates. Harden’s longevity and continued production are a masterclass in basketball IQ and skill refinement.

Towns & Shamet Ignite Knicks Offense, Diabaté Shines for Hornets

The New York Knicks benefited from a scorching night from Karl-Anthony Towns (39 points) and Landry Shamet (36 points), who combined for 75 points in a dominant 140-132 victory over the Miami Heat. Shamet’s performance was a career-best, coming off the bench to provide a crucial scoring punch. Meanwhile, across the league, Moussa Diabaté impressed with a double-double of 15 points and 11 rebounds for the Charlotte Hornets, despite their overtime loss to the Milwaukee Bucks. These performances demonstrate the depth of talent emerging across the NBA and the potential for unexpected stars to rise.
